Leveraging role play to explore software and game development process.
Adrienne DeckerDavid SimkinsPublished in: FIE (2016)
Keyphrases
- development process
- role play
- software development
- project management
- software engineering
- software quality
- software projects
- case study
- collaborative learning
- virtual environment
- development cycle
- systems development
- software application
- game development
- metamodel
- functional requirements
- design process
- development projects
- requirements engineering
- software requirements
- digital games
- development processes
- conflict resolution
- database
- requirements specification
- software reuse
- software components
- software systems
- development team
- games based learning
- software design
- life cycle
- machine learning
- real world